Introducing Girard-Perregaux’s New Minute Repeater Flying Bridges

Increase FontSizeDecrease FontSize
02-Apr-2026

Introducing Girard-Perregaux’s Minute Repeater Flying Bridges, powered by the in-house GP9530 calibre. This 475-part openworked movement combines a minute repeater, tourbillon, and new self-winding system, requiring nearly 440 hours of assembly and decoration. It reimagines the brand’s iconic Three Bridges architecture with a contemporary design, including a rear-positioned third bridge and arrow-shaped ends reflecting Girard-Perregaux’s forward-looking DNA. Developed to enhance acoustic clarity, diffusion, and resonance, the calibre blends technical mastery with aesthetic excellence. Marrying 18th-century expertise with 21st-century engineering, it embodies avant-garde Haute Horlogerie, offering a modern, transparent interpretation of a complication that has defined the Manufacture since the 1820s.
